casestatus.in Summary

Summary of SLP(C) No. 18619-18620/2007 On 24/08/2009, the Supreme Court (Justices Tarun Chatterjee and R.M. Lodha) heard the Special Leave Petitions filed by Thomas Ansalam against K.A. Antony, challenging a Kerala High Court order dated 19/06/2007. The Court dismissed the application for impleadment and declined to interfere with the impugned order, thereby dismissing the Special Leave Petitions.
